Understanding Special Diets and Their Importance

Special diets refer to eating plans tailored to meet specific health needs, lifestyle choices, or cultural preferences. These diets are often necessary for individuals with medical conditions such as diabetes, allergies, or cardiovascular diseases. Others may follow special diets for ethical reasons like vegetarianism or veganism, or for religious observances. Knowing the terminology related to special diets in Nepali can be essential for travelers, expatriates, or language learners who want to maintain their dietary regimen in Nepal.

Common Special Diets and Their Nepali Terminology

To facilitate communication about dietary needs in Nepali, it’s beneficial to learn the names and descriptions of common special diets. Below are some frequently followed diets along with their Nepali translations and explanations.

1. Vegetarian Diet (शाकाहारी आहार – Shakahari Aahar)

A vegetarian diet excludes meat, fish, and poultry but may include dairy and eggs depending on the type of vegetarianism.

2. Vegan Diet (शुद्ध शाकाहारी – Shuddha Shakahari)

The vegan diet eliminates all animal products, including dairy, eggs, and honey.

3. Gluten-Free Diet (ग्लुटेनरहित आहार – Gluten Rahit Aahar)

This diet avoids gluten, a protein found in wheat, barley, rye, and related grains, essential for people with celiac disease or gluten intolerance.

4. Diabetic Diet (मधुमेह आहार – Madhumeh Aahar)

A diabetic diet focuses on controlling blood sugar levels through balanced intake of carbohydrates, proteins, and fats.

5. Low-Carbohydrate Diet (कम कार्बोहाइड्रेट आहार – Kam Carbohydrate Aahar)

This diet restricts carbohydrate intake to promote weight loss or manage certain health conditions.

6. Ketogenic Diet (किटोजेनिक आहार – Ketogenic Aahar)

A very low-carb, high-fat diet that induces ketosis, a metabolic state beneficial for weight loss and some neurological conditions.
